In this episode, Lucy Liu, Co-Founder and President of Airwallex, joins The First to share the journey behind building one of APAC’s most globally scaled fintech companies.
Lucy’s story is one of global perspective, technical ambition, and long-term conviction, shaped by an upbringing across China, New Zealand, and Australia, a finance education in Melbourne, and early years in banking and investment consulting. While she valued the structure and learning of the corporate world, Lucy ultimately felt compelled to build something enduring, leading her to join her co-founders in launching Airwallex in 2015.
Founded in Melbourne and now headquartered in Singapore, Airwallex has grown into a global financial platform supporting businesses of all sizes. Its products span global business accounts, FX and payments, expense cards, payroll, and investment products. Today, Airwallex is valued at US$8 billion and stands as Australia’s third technology unicorn - proof that globally ambitious companies can be built from the region.
Lucy reflects on the early years of Airwallex, including a first product that they pivoted from to find traction and the defining decision to invest deeply in infrastructure rather than quick wins. By building core systems, such as FX engines and clearing networks, from day one, Airwallex laid the foundation for scale long before revenue arrived. That patience enabled rapid product expansion and global reach in later years.
The conversation offers a clearer look at what it takes to scale a regulated fintech: navigating licensing uncertainty, balancing speed with compliance, and convincing investors to back a long-term vision. Lucy shares how the company retained Melbourne as an engineering hub, and why direct, transparent engagement with regulators became a critical advantage. The launch of Airwallex’s multi-currency card products in 2019 marked a major inflection point, just ahead of COVID accelerating global demand for digital banking.
Beyond the business, Lucy speaks openly about her own evolution, from a finance professional to a founder forced into sales, investor meetings, and regulatory conversations. She discusses scaling culture to over 2,000 employees through a shared set of operating principles, learning to delegate, and growing herself as the company doubled year after year.
Looking ahead, Lucy envisions a future where technology companies like Airwallex redefine global banking, powered by superior user experience, AI-enabled tools, and truly borderless financial infrastructure.
